UNACCOMPANIED MINOR

    • Unaccompanied minors are children 8 to below 12 years old on the date of travel.

    • Must travel without an accompanying passenger aged 18 or older.

    • Child must be accompanied to the departure airport by an adult who provides assurance that another adult will meet the child at the destination.

    • Advance notice is required for proper arrangements.

    • Proof of age may be required.

    Travel Requirements

    Children 8 to below 12 years old:

    • Must have a Special Handling Information Sheet (SHIS) completed and signed by parent/guardian.

    Children 12 years and older:

    • May travel unaccompanied with proof of age.

    Children below 8 years old:

    • Can only travel if accompanied by someone 18 years or older.

    Additional Conditions

    UMNR passengers must be confirmed on all flight sectors until the final destination.
